Best Things About the Resort:
Service, room - no bugs, pool is very nice, the shower, the two double beds in the 2nd bedroom.

Resort Experience:
It's a very nice place to stay. I'm not sure if I was in Kona Coast I or II but it was very nice. We had a unit close to the pool but without an ocean view (that is the only thing that would have made it better). They have everything you need (except muffin pans). The activity directors are not very helpful - the one downside to this resort. The security personnel are very nice. We really enjoyed our condo experience. Not a lot of activities for the kids - not as family oriented as others I've stayed in.

Jack's Dive Shop

Activity

My husband decided to do his checkout dives for PADI in Kona. He found Jack's to be the most resonable place to do this on the island. The staff was very nice and hooked him up with someone to do that. Additionally he made it available for us to snorkel and be with him one of the two days he checked out. While he did scuba we snorkeled - it was great. The staff was wonderful (we have two young children and they again were very good with them). Use Jack's dive shop if you want to check out in paradise.
